Passaic County, New Jersey represents one of the most dynamic and diverse real estate markets in the New York metropolitan area, characterized by a compelling mix of urban renewal, suburban stability, and surprising affordability compared to neighboring counties. With 1,863 actively licensed real estate agents serving the region—all of whom maintain email connectivity—the market demonstrates both professional density and digital sophistication that reflects the area's proximity to major employment centers.

The county's real estate landscape spans from the bustling urban corridors of Paterson and Passaic to the affluent suburban enclaves of Wayne and West Milford, creating distinct micro-markets that require specialized local knowledge. This geographic and economic diversity has made Passaic County increasingly attractive to both first-time homebuyers seeking value and investors capitalizing on gentrification trends in historically overlooked neighborhoods.

Major Passaic County, New Jersey Real Estate Markets

The Paterson metropolitan area anchors the county's urban real estate activity, where historic brownstones and converted industrial properties are experiencing unprecedented demand from buyers priced out of Brooklyn and Manhattan. Meanwhile, Wayne and Pompton Lakes represent the county's suburban gold standard, featuring highly-rated school districts and easy commuter access that consistently drive property values above county averages.

Northern communities like Ringwood and Wanaque offer a surprising rural character within the New York metro sphere, attracting buyers seeking larger lots and outdoor recreation opportunities. The western regions, including West Milford and portions of Bloomingdale, have emerged as hidden gems where lake communities and mountain properties provide resort-like living at commutable distances to major business districts.

Market Dynamics and Geographic Complexity

Passaic County's real estate market operates with fascinating contradictions—while overall inventory remains tight, certain neighborhoods in Paterson and Clifton are experiencing rapid turnover as young professionals discover affordable alternatives to Bergen County pricing. The county's 16 municipalities each maintain distinct character and pricing structures, from Hawthorne's mid-century ranch homes to Haledon's Victorian-era properties.

Transportation infrastructure significantly influences market dynamics, with proximity to major highways and NJ Transit lines creating premium corridors that command 15-20% higher prices than comparable properties just miles away. The ongoing development of mixed-use projects in downtown Paterson and continued investment in recreational facilities throughout the county signal long-term growth potential that savvy agents are positioning their clients to capture.
